Restrict the data values that can be added to a table column. Also see Constraint Clause (Table)
Syntax - In line Constraint:
   CONSTRAINT constrnt_name {UNIQUE|PRIMARY KEY} constrnt_state
   CONSTRAINT constrnt_name CHECK(condition) constrnt_state
   CONSTRAINT constrnt_name [NOT] NULL constrnt_state
   CONSTRAINT constrnt_name REFERENCES [schema.]table [(column)]
      [ON DELETE {CASCADE|SET NULL}] constrnt_state
Syntax - Out of line Constraint:
   CONSTRAINT constrnt_name {UNIQUE|PRIMARY KEY}(column [,column…]) constrnt_state
   CONSTRAINT constrnt_name CHECK(condition) constrnt_state
   CONSTRAINT constrnt_name FOREIGN KEY [schema.]table [(column)]
      REFERENCES [schema.]table [(column)]
        [ON DELETE {CASCADE|SET NULL}] constrnt_state
Syntax - Inline Column Referential Constraint:
   SCOPE IS schema.scope_table
   WITH ROWID
  [CONSTRAINT constrnt_name] REFERENCES [schema.]table (column [,column…])
      [ON DELETE {CASCADE|SET NULL}] constrnt_state [constrnt_state]
'column' can be either a single column name or several columns separated with commas.
Options:
constrnt_state   
    [[NOT] DEFERRABLE] [INITIALLY {IMMEDIATE|DEFERRED}]
       [RELY | NORELY] [USING INDEX using_index_clause]
          [ENABLE|DISABLE] [VALIDATE|NOVALIDATE]
              [EXCEPTIONS INTO [schema.]table]
using_index_clause
    Schema.index
    (CREATE INDEX statement)
    PCTFREE int
    INITTRANS int
    MAXTRANS int
    TABLESPACE tablespace_name
    STORAGE storage_clause
    SORT | NOSORT
    LOGGING|NOLOGGING
    {LOCAL|GLOBAL} PARTITION BY RANGE(column_list)( partition_clause,…)}
partition_clause:
   PARTITION partition VALUES LESS THAN (values list) ptn_storage
   ptn_storage:
      PCTFREE int
      PCTUSED int
      INITTRANS int
      MAXTRANS int
      STORAGE storage_clause
      TABLESPACE tablespace
      LOGGING|NOLOGGING
condition:
An expression that evaluate to TRUE, FALSE or unknown.
   Some examples:
   emp_name = 'SMITH' 
   emp_name IN ('SMITH', 'JONES', 'FRASER') 
   hiredate > '01-JAN-01'
   employees.dept_id = departments.dept_id_pk
   EMP_sal >5000 AND emp_commission IS NULL
  A referential column constraint with ON DELETE CASCADE will cascade deletes 
  - so deleting a primary key row will delete all related foreign keys. 
e.g. delete a customer and all that customer's orders will disappear.
To constrain the maximum value stored in a NUMBER column, a simple alternative is to set a PRECISION on the table column, this restricts the length (i.e. number of digits) that can be inserted.

Valid constraint_types are:
  
  
  Primary key     = P 
  
  Unique Key      = U 
  
  Foreign Key     = R 
  
  Check, not null = C 
  
Check (view)    = V
